Output afba56822612a45c525fc1b15e95b4857bf0aafb39f0dcd193981d72f78c49cb:25

value
57494815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 929b0c01301fcad962d9712d0f3fade1e1cde4a7 OP_EQUAL
address
MMGLdHT4HH2WiY5KrxGSmwf7eTFz4iQ9T6
transaction
afba56822612a45c525fc1b15e95b4857bf0aafb39f0dcd193981d72f78c49cb
spent
true